    I really forgot just how bad Italian Motors Sales and Service was like. First they told me not to use hyper-flow cats because they would not pass HK emissions tests (and IMSS sell the OEM item for HK$10k more!!!) so I went ahead and ordered them anyway. Passed emission test no problem.

    I had taken the car in to have all the fluids changed and to check another couple of things as I had just bought it. When I got it back, there was a terrible vibration coming thru the clutch, gearshift and steering wheel. The vibration was so bad, my left foot went numb very quickly. Took the car back, said sort it out cos it was not like that when I gave it to you. They call me back and say the Clutch bearing is shot and oh, btw, the clutch is over 50% worn out... HK$18k for a new clutch. Now I can't prove they buggered it up in the first place but I have my suspicions.

    They keep saying they're gonna call me back and never do. It's always me chasing them for an update. Then to top it all, they told me yesterday the car would'nt be ready for Saturday afternoon as they are still working on it. I drove by and the car was sitting there, no one working on it at all.

    They just a) don't give a rats ass about their customers because they've got a monopoly and b) try to rip us off with overpriced parts and labour.

    This was the same level of service I had with my last 355 but this time I'm not taking it lightly. I'm going to write to Ferrari in Italy to let them know what's going on and I would ask anyone else with similar experiences to do the same. This will force Ferrari to contact IMSS to see what's going on then maybe, just maybe, IMSS will sit up and start paying attention to their "customers".

    Rant over.
